FOS reported that NBA star LeBron James has a commercial contract with prediction market platform Polymarket worth $15 million a year, sparking debate among the community and fans. According to Odaily, journalist Siegel said NBA players' outside business deals do not necessarily violate the current collective bargaining agreement, but future arrangements could resemble salary cap circumvention if players accept lower NBA contracts because of off-court income. Siegel added that the NBA is likely to pay closer attention if outside earnings and team payrolls become clearly linked.
